There were a lot of problems with this hotel right from the start. Upon check in there was no one at the front desk and I had to wait 5 to 10 minutes before anyone showed up. Internet wasn't reachable in the first room I was assigned. Going in the room, the curtains were not completely attached to the curtain rod. Room smelled old. Air conditioner a bit loud though not to bad - A/C was very cold. No soap in the bathroom. I saw a roach afternoon, night, and morning. Probably related to that is a nearly overfilled dumpster not so far from the room. It takes 6 to 8 seconds to switch channels (and while I was watching the presidential debate, the signal actually cut out for a few minutes). There was no breakfast. Health inspection rating posted on wall was 72/100 (May 2016). On the plus side, the room itself was clean (despite the roaches), the courtyard was spacious (empty pool though), surrounding wooded area is tranquil, cost is not high. Athens Lodge is supposed to be in progress of becoming Red Roof Inn. If they get their act together (especially with pest control), it has potential to easily beat out other entry level hotels in the area, but as it stands I can not recommend this place. Although not a horrible experience, to be honest this was the worst hotel I've ever stayed in.
